## Deployment

Gridsmith, our crossword generator, ships as a single container behind the Harrowgate reverse proxy. It has no inbound dependencies besides the dictionary volume, which is mounted read-only. All puzzle seeds are generated server-side; nothing user-supplied reaches the solver. For your review, the deployment pipeline injects the runtime settings at startup, and the full set currently applied in production is listed here.

deployment values, fadug-bawif:
SORWYN_LOG_LEVEL=debug
SORWYN_METRICS_HOST=metrics.sorwyn.qirvansys.internal
SORWYN_POOL_SIZE=32

Account Recovery — Quillhaven Functions. Cold starts on the recovery handlers can exceed 20 seconds, so a timeout on the first reset attempt is expected, not a failure. Warm the pool with a synthetic invocation, confirm the handler version matches the pinned release, then retry the user's recovery flow. If the second attempt also stalls, bypass via the manual console and authenticate using the passphrase that follows.

vault phrase of yagag-kadup = belael-druius-rusax-kelox

## ProfileVault Environments

ProfileVault shards the user-profile store across four partitions in staging and sixteen in production. Shard assignment is hash-based on account ID, so rebalancing only happens during planned resharding windows. If you're on call and see hot-shard alerts, check the partition map before touching anything — most pages resolve to a single overloaded shard. The active shard configuration for production is as follows.

settings of hahag-taweg:
[jorius]
team = gilox
access_code = ac_b64218
host = jorius.zarqelstack.example
port = 8080
owner = quenath.briax
peer = eliix.halixcloud.corp